moonlight becomes me
i wish i could capture it
save it in a jar
for the nights when the moon hides
and nothing but heartache shines
~ copyright 2015 RC deWinter
Moonlight illuminates an antique bottle, candlestick and lidded pitcher in a window of a mid-19th Century house at Mystic Seaport in New London, Connecticut.
